Sat 331708598800608

decimal
66341.3598800608
degree
0°66341′1829″3598800608‴
percentile
15.795647579308932%
name
lmqrzcfspkz
cycle
0
epoch
0
period
32
block
66341
offset
3598800608
timestamp
rarity
common